I'm a new COADE Tank software user.

Now I'm designing a CRT Tank (mat'l A283-C) and need your advice.

DESIGN DATA:
- ID = 17 m
- Height = 16 m
- Design Pressure = Full Liquid+100 mm H2O
- Design Ext Pressure = 50 mm H2O
- Design Temp. = 70 C degree
- Design Liquid Level = 16 m
- Liquid SG = 1
- Corrosion Allowance = 1.5 mm
- Site Class E
- Sp = 0.3
- Ss = 0.75
- S1 = 0.375
- SDs = 0.6
- I = 1.25
- Rwi = 4
- Wind velosity = 25 m/s

After I calculate using COADE Tank, I found this tank is un-anchored, J = 1.0554.
When I checked the calculation output, the value Ai = 0.066964, it means this Ai is got from API equation E.4.6.1-3.

Could you kindly advise wether we can use this Ai value, even when we manually check using API equation E.4.6.1-1, we will get higher Ai value (0.1875)?

Amar,

You said the report shows the value calculated according to E.4.6.1-3, which is a threshold of Ai≥0.625*Sp*I/Rwi valid for S1≥0.6

First, your S1 is less than 0.6 so you are not in that case!
Second, it seems you are right that the threshold is calculated as 0.5*S1*I/Rwi=0.5*0.375*1.25/3.5= 0.066964, even S1 is less than 0.6.

Why Tank reports such value of Ai instead one based on E.4.6.1-1? I have no idea, I cannot check your output anyway.
Here Intergraph team can help you giving an answer.


About your manually check giving value Ai=0.6*1.25/4=0.1875, I have also some remarks.

- Your SDs value cannot be SDs = 0.6, I don't know from where is coming up that value.
In fact in E.4.6.1-1, API considers SDs which is specific to ASCE 7 and failed to develop a similar formula for non-ASCE sites.
For non-ASCE sites, SDs must be substituted by Fa*Ss (the definition of SDs is given in API 650/ E.2.2 Notations as SDS=Q*Fa*Ss where Q=1 for non-ASCE sites)
I think you must consider SDs=1.2*0.75 for your site E.

-About your value of Rwi, you must see the the table Table E.4, where Rwi=3.5 for non-anchored tanks.

Mario,

Thanks for your feed back.

I'm sorry, I forgot to inform that the tank was designed
based on API 650 11th Ed., Add. 2 as Client requirement, not
the latest one.

In this edition there is no requirement for S1≥0.6;
the equation E.4.6.1-3

Ai≥0.5S1(I/Rwi) = 0.625SP (I/Rwi) is for Site Class E & F.

Regarding Rwi, I would like to inform
- At first I calculated using COADE Tank, and set
as un-unchored tank; Rwi=3.5.
- Since Client requested Anchor Bolt for the tank, then, I re-calculated,
and set as anchored tank.
Rwi = 4. I want to correct, the Ai=0.058594 (not 0.066964 as
my previous info).

Based on my calculation using COADE Tank, the software always
take the smaller Ai value (0.058594), even the equation E.4.6.1-1
will produce higher Ai value.

Pls Integraph team to advise (I utilized COADE Tank ver. 3.30.
